Kansas City, MO. – The Nonprofit Leadership Alliance is excited to welcome a new campus partnership with Alvin Community College (ACC) to bring the nationally recognized Certified Nonprofit Professional (CNP) credential to ACC students at a discounted rate.
Through this partnership, ACC students will have a unique opportunity to earn the nation’s only nationally recognized nonprofit credential, equipping them with the skills and knowledge necessary to drive meaningful change in their communities and beyond. This initiative aligns with ACC’s commitment to providing students with valuable, career-enhancing opportunities.
Shaping the Future Through Nonprofit Leaders
The Nonprofit Leadership Alliance is dedicated to educating, preparing, and nurturing the next generation of compassionate, skilled nonprofit leaders. By identifying college students with a passion for service and encouraging their personal and professional growth, the Alliance develops individuals with the leadership ability to positively influence social change through the nonprofit sector.
Dorothy Norris-Tirrell, Ph.D., CNP (President) shared, “By equipping students with the knowledge, skills, and abilities to earn the Certified Nonprofit Professional (CNP) credential, we are not only investing in their professional growth but also in the betterment of communities across the nation. This partnership embodies our mission to empower the future leaders of the nonprofit sector to drive meaningful social change.”
About the Nonprofit Leadership Alliance
For more than 75 years, the Nonprofit Leadership Alliance has helped nonprofit professionals perform better in their jobs. We change the world by making sure that nonprofit organizations have the talented workforce needed to fulfill their missions. Our programs develop individual leaders so that their organizations are stronger and more effective in turn. The Certified Nonprofit Professional (CNP) credential and Leaderosity, our core talent development programs, lift the quality of life in all communities by building social sector leaders ready for the challenges of today’s world.
